How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Pierce County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pierce County Studio Apartments | $1,344 | $564 | $2,874 |
| Pierce County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,664 | $612 | $3,881 |
| Pierce County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,049 | $735 | $5,190 |
| Pierce County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,603 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Pierce County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,407 | $2,088 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pierce County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Pierce County?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Pierce County with Washer/Dryer is at Orchard Heights Apartments listed at $515.
How much is the average rent for Pierce County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Pierce County with Washer/Dryer is $2,006.
What is the largest Pierce County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Pierce County is a 2,300 square feet unit starting from $2,500 at Victorian.
What is the average size for Pierce County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Pierce County is currently at 724 sq ft.
